集群的概述与定义,一看就会

大家好,今天分享有关于集群的概述和定义

我们第一个问题就是:

什么是集群:

将很多的服务器集中到一块,使他们成为一个整体,由一个统一的机器(服务器)进行管理,实现 对大量数据信息的处理

以下是百度的的结果

集群是一组相互独立的、通过高速网络互联的计算机,它们构成了一个组,并以单一系统的模式加以管理。一个客户与集群相互作用时,集群像是一个独立的服务器。集群配置是用于提高可用性和可缩放性。

我的大白话就是
调度器指挥这一堆相互独立的计算机去做一件事,这样的一套系统,就是集群

关于集群的特点

可以

在低成本的情况下,实现服务器的性能,可靠性,灵活度(也是做集群的目的)

关于集群的核心在于调度器

做集群的目的

  1. 在于性能的提升(就是计算能力以及处理高并发数据流量的能力)
  2. 在于 成本的降低(因为,相较于超级计算机高昂的价格,由传统服务器所构建的集群大大的使成本得到有效压缩)
  3. 在于可以提高可扩展性(就是,如果需要改动,直接对服务器节点进行增加或删除就可以了)

集群对于用户而言的感受就是:(于用户收到可视化界面而言)

不管在处理请求的集群当中, 究竟使用了多少台服务器,用户都会认为是一台服务器在实际工作

有关于集群的分类

1.高性能计算集群 (HPC),就是通过集群开发,让应用程序得以并行的状态出现,主要是为了大量的科学复杂问题得以解决

在这里插入图片描述

  1. 负载均衡集群(LB),就是说,在这样的集群当中,所处理的客户端的数据信息流量,尽可能的以平均分配的方式交给集群当中真实工作的服务器

在这里插入图片描述

在比如说,100G的流量分给10台服务器,每一台服务器处理10g的流量
3. 高可用集群(HA),就是在这样的集群当中,单台的服务器出现意外情况,可以实现快速的迁移与备份,目的是是为了避免单点的故障

在这里插入图片描述

LVS 介绍
lvs ,是linux虚拟服务器的简称,是章文嵩博士在读书期间创建的

lvs可以实现高可用以及负载均衡

是Linux系统内嵌的功能和服务

关于lvs的架构图:

它的目的是利用linux和lvs实现高可用,高性能,低成本的集群环境

在这里插入图片描述

lvs的组成部分
前端:负载均衡层
就是由一台或多台调度器构成的一层

我画起来的那个,就是调度器

在这里插入图片描述

中间: 是一堆真实干活的服务器
在这里插入图片描述
后端:
负责数据共享的一层(在下面的图)
在这里插入图片描述

在lvs集群当中,还有一些名称专业术语

  1. Directoy : 这是调度器 (集群的核心)
  2. real server : 真实服务器(真正处理数据,真正干活的服务器)
  3. VIP :给用户用于访问的IP地址
  4. RIP : 真实ip地址 (服务器节点在集群当中用于和其它节点通信真实的ip地址)
  5. DIP : 调度器连接节点服务器的ip地址

还有一个 : CIP (客户端的ip地址,这个不在集群的管辖范围之中)

好了,到这里,我们有关于集群的概述与定义就到这里了,谢谢大家

  • 4
    点赞
  • 31
    收藏
    觉得还不错? 一键收藏
  • 打赏
    打赏
  • 0
    评论
F CDC(Change Data Capture)是基于 Apache Flink 的一个功能,用于捕获和处理数据源的变更。它可以用来实时捕获数据源中的变更,并将其发送到其他系统进行处理。 要搭建一个 Flink CDC 集群,你可以按照以下步骤进行操作: 1. 安装 Apache Flink:首先,你需要安装 Apache Flink。可以从官方网站下载二进制文件,然后按照官方文档进行安装和配置。 2. 配置 Flink CDC:在 Flink 的配置文件中,你需要进行一些特定的配置来启用 CDC 功能。主要的配置项包括指定需要监控的数据源、定义 CDC 数据流的目标和格式等。 3. 启动 Flink 集群:一旦配置完成,你可以启动 Flink 集群。这将启动 Flink 的 JobManager 和 TaskManager,它们将协同工作来执行你在 Flink 中定义的任务。 4. 编写 CDC 任务:使用 Flink 的 Java 或 Scala API,你可以编写 CDC 任务来定义如何捕获和处理数据源的变更。你可以指定需要监控的表、变更事件的过滤条件以及如何将变更数据发送到其他系统。 5. 提交和执行任务:将编写好的 CDC 任务打包成 JAR 文件,并使用 Flink 提供的命令行工具或 REST API 提交任务。一旦任务提交成功,Flink 就启动并执行你定义的 CDC 逻辑。 请注意,以上步骤仅为简要概述,实际操作中可能还涉及到更多细节和配置。你可以参考 Flink 的官方文档以获取更详细的指导和示例。

“相关推荐”对你有帮助么?

  • 非常没帮助
  • 没帮助
  • 一般
  • 有帮助
  • 非常有帮助
提交
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包

打赏作者

思诚代码块

你的鼓励将是我创作的最大动力

¥1 ¥2 ¥4 ¥6 ¥10 ¥20
扫码支付:¥1
获取中
扫码支付

您的余额不足,请更换扫码支付或充值

打赏作者

实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值